100 days 100 short stories:: story 57

story: Those Are as Brothers

author: Nancy Hale

year: 1942

where: in the sky, near Chicago

note: started this story on the other side of the Atlantic before falling asleep

a line: “She was sorry for him because he was a refugee and because he had been in a concentration camp in Germany, and it was necessary to be kind to those who had suffered under that Hitler, but a Jew was a Jew; there were right German names and wrong German names; Fräulein’s name was Strasser.”
